Introduction

It’s been a privilege to work for more than twenty years as a therapist and clinical social worker. I’ve had the honor of walking alongside my clients and bearing witness to some of their most life-changing and difficult experiences as they navigate changes in mental health, sense of self, relationships, and quality of life. About Me: I am a licensed clinical social worker (LCSW) and board certified diplomate (BCD) in clinical social work. I have masters (MSW) and doctorate (Ph.D.) degrees in social work and am a qualified clinical supervisor. I began my career as a therapist in 2005 at a psychiatric hospital working with individuals experiencing severe mental illness. Since then I have provided individual, group, and family therapy to adults and adolescents in community health centers, IOP/PHP programs, and private practices. I also supervised medical and doctoral students in pro-bono clinics and worked on contracts with Corrections and Healthy Start. I currently own and operate Atlantic Psychotherapy, LLC. My therapeutic approach and interventions also reflect my work as an assistant professor/instructor and researcher between 2015 - 2025. My research explored treatment interventions and the lived experiences of bipolar disorder, depression, and posttraumatic stress disorder.
